

Complete documentation: 1102 properties, 151 functions, 71 events, 167 enums. Click any row to expand details.
| Object | Description | Chart Types |
|---|---|---|
| Pego | Categorical (Y data only), discontinuous date-time, multi-axis with table | Bar, Line, Area, Spline, Point, Step, Ribbon, Stacked Bar/Area/Line, Horizontal Bar, OHLC, High-Low, Box Plot |
| Pesgo | XY scatter/scientific charting (X and Y data), continuous date-time, multi-axis | Line, Bar, Point, Area, Spline, Step, Bubble, Stick, Contour Lines/Colors/Shaded, Gpu-Side rendering Real-Time |
| Pe3do | 3D surface rendering with rotation, lighting, and Gpu-Side rendering | Surface, Surface Contour, Surface Shading, Surface Pixel, Wire, Bar, Scatter, Waterfall, Poly data, Real-Time |
| Pepso | Polar, Smith, and Rose, intelligent zooming rebuilds grid lines | Polar Line, Polar Point, Polar Area, Smith / Admittance, Rose Chart |
| Pepco | Pie chart with intelligent labels, grouping, gradients | 2D Pie, 2D Exploded Pie, 3D Pie, 3D Exploded Pie |
| Property | .NET Name | Type | Description | |
|---|---|---|---|---|
| ActivelyScrolling | PeSpecial.ActivelyScrolling | Boolean/Int32 | This property may be rarely needed and used internally when we need to know if image is in the process of being scrolled. S... | |
| AdjoinBars | PePlot.Option.AdjoinBars | Boolean/Int32 | Set True to force bar charts to draw bars with no gaps between bars. AdjoinBars is a feature added for some specific purpose... | |
| AllDodging | PeAnnotation.Graph.AllDodging | Boolean | Enables non pointer type (symbol) text to try limited dodging but text will not expand far away from the symbol. Else if fal... | |
| AllDodgingOffset | PeAnnotation.Graph.AllDodgingOffset | Int32 | Related to AllDodging property, this property controls the pixel offset from the target position to avoid the symbol being a... | |
| AllowAnnotationControl1ex | PeUserInterface.Menu.AnnotationControl | Boolean/Int32 | This property controls whether a menu item is added to the popup-menu which allows the user to control whether annotations a... | |
| AllowArea3ex | PePlot.Allow.Area | Boolean/Int32 | This property controls whether the Area plotting method is accessible to the user. The 3D Scientific Graph object uses the ... | |
| AllowAxisHotSpots | PeUserInterface.HotSpot.Axis | Boolean/Int32 | This property controls whether axes will be Hot-Spots. The developer can then respond when the user clicks or double-clicks ... | |
| AllowAxisLabelHotSpots1ex | PeUserInterface.HotSpot.AxisLabel | Boolean/Int32 | This property controls whether axis labels will be Hot-Spots. The developer can then respond when the user clicks or double-... | |
| AllowAxisPage3ex | PeUserInterface.Dialog.Axis | Boolean/Int32 | This property controls whether the Axis property page is visible. Property pages are shown in the customization dialog. The ... | |
| AllowBar3ex | PePlot.Allow.Bar | Boolean/Int32 | This property controls whether the Bar plotting method is accessible to the user. Setting | Description TRUE | Bar Graph is... | |
| AllowBestFitCurve3ex | PePlot.Allow.BestFitCurve | Boolean/Int32 | This property controls whether the Points plus Best Fit Curve plotting method is accessible to the user. Setting | Descript... | |
| AllowBestFitCurveII | PePlot.Allow.BestFitCurveGraphed | Boolean/Int32 | This property controls whether the Points plus Best Fit Curve II plotting method is accessible to the user. This property pr... | |
| AllowBestFitLine3ex | PePlot.Allow.BestFitLine | Boolean/Int32 | This property controls whether the Points plus Best Fit Line plotting method is accessible to the user. Setting | Descripti... | |
| AllowBestFitLineII | PePlot.Allow.BestFitLineGraphed | Boolean/Int32 | This property controls whether the Points plus Best Fit Line II plotting method is accessible to the user. This property pro... | |
| AllowBottomTitleHotSpots | PeUserInterface.HotSpot.MultiBottomTitle | Boolean/Int32 | This property controls whether MultiBottomTitles will be Hot-Spots. The developer can then respond when the user clicks or d... | |
| AllowBubble1ex | PePlot.Allow.Bubble | Boolean/Int32 | This property controls whether the Bubble plotting method is accessible to the user. Setting | Description TRUE | Bubble Gr... | |
| AllowColorPage | PeUserInterface.Dialog.Color | Boolean/Int32 | This property controls whether the Color property page is visible. Property pages are shown in the customization dialog. The... | |
| AllowContourColors3ex | PePlot.Allow.ContourColors | Boolean/Int32 | This property controls whether the Contour Colors plotting method is accessible to the user. Setting | Description TRUE | C... | |
| AllowContourControl | - | Boolean/Int32 | This property controls whether a menu item is added to the popup-menu that allows the user to control the ShowContour proper... | |
| AllowContourLines2ex | PePlot.Allow.ContourLines | Boolean/Int32 | This property controls whether the Contour Lines plotting method is accessible to the user. Setting | Description TRUE | Co... | |
| AllowCoordPrompting | PeUserInterface.Allow.CoordinatePrompting | Boolean/Int32 | This property controls whether the user will receive coordinate feedback when they double-click the graphs grid. When the gr... | |
| AllowCustomization | PeUserInterface.Allow.Customization | Boolean/Int32 | This property controls whether the user can access the Customization Dialog. Setting | Description TRUE | User can access C... | |
| AllowDataHotSpots1ex | PeUserInterface.HotSpot.Data | Boolean/Int32 | This property controls whether data-points will be Hot-Spots. The developer can then respond when the user clicks or double-... | |
| AllowDataLabels | PePlot.Option.AllowDataLabels | Int32 | This property controls what type of data-point labels can be placed next to data-points. Setting | Description PEADL_NONE (... | |
| AllowDebugOutput | - | Boolean/Int32 | This property controls whether the ProEssentials DLL sends debug warnings to the debug terminal. Setting | Description TRUE... | |
| AllowEmfExport1ex | PeUserInterface.Dialog.AllowEmfExport | Boolean/Int32 | This property controls whether the user can access exporting Enhanced MetaFiles (EMF) images from the Export Dialog. Settin... | |
| AllowExporting | PeUserInterface.Allow.Exporting | Boolean/Int32 | This property controls whether the user will have access to export capabilities. Setting | Description TRUE | User can acce... | |
| AllowFontPage | PeUserInterface.Dialog.Font | Boolean/Int32 | This property controls whether the Font property page is visible. Property pages are shown in the customization dialog. The ... | |
| AllowGraphAnnotHotSpots3ex | PeUserInterface.HotSpot.GraphAnnotation | Enum or Boolean / Int32 | This property controls whether graph annotations will be Hot-Spots. The developer can then respond when the user clicks or d... | |
| AllowGraphHotSpots | PeUserInterface.HotSpot.Graph | Boolean/Int32 | This property controls whether the graphs grid will be a Hot-Spot. The developer can then respond when the user clicks or do... | |
| AllowGridNumberHotSpotsX2ex | PeUserInterface.HotSpot.GridNumberX | Boolean/Int32 | This property controls whether x grid numbers will be Hot-Spots. The developer can then respond when the user clicks or doub... | |
| AllowGridNumberHotSpotsY2ex | PeUserInterface.HotSpot.GridNumberY | Boolean/Int32 | This property controls whether y grid numbers will be Hot-Spots. The developer can then respond when the user clicks or doub... | |
| AllowHistogram1ex | PePlot.Allow.Histogram | Boolean/Int32 | This property controls whether the Histogram plotting method is accessible to the user. Setting | Description TRUE | Histog... | |
| AllowHorizontalBar | PePlot.Allow.HorziontalBar | Boolean/Int32 | This property controls whether the Horizontal Bar plotting method is accessible to the user. Setting | Description TRUE | H... | |
| AllowHorzBarStacked2ex | PePlot.Allow.HorzBarStacked | Boolean/Int32 | This property controls whether the Horizontal Stacked Bar plotting method is accessible to the user. Setting | Description ... | |
| AllowHorzLineAnnotHotSpots | PeUserInterface.HotSpot.YAxisLineAnnotation | Enum / Int32 | This property controls whether horizontal line annotations will be Hot-Spots. The developer can then respond when the user c... | |
| AllowHorzScrollBar | PeUserInterface.Scrollbar.HorzScrollBar | Boolean/Int32 | This property controls whether a horizontal scroll bar will be available to allow the user to rotate the image. Setting | D... | |
| AllowJpegOutput | PeUserInterface.Dialog.AllowJpegExport | Boolean/Int32 | This property controls whether the user can access exporting JPEG images from the Export Dialog. Setting | Description TRUE... | |
| AllowLargerLegendWidth1ex | PeLegend.AllowLargerLegendWidth | Int32 | This feature helps when your implementation potentially shows small controls / charts within your windows. Defines a thresh... | |
| AllowLine3ex | PePlot.Allow.Line | Boolean/Int32 | This property controls whether the Line plotting method is accessible to user. Setting | Description TRUE | Line Graph is a... | |
| AllowMaximization3ex | PeUserInterface.Allow.Maximization | Boolean/Int32 | This property controls whether the user will have access to maximizing the object. Setting | Description TRUE | User can ma... | |
| AllowOleExport | - | Boolean/Int32 | This property controls whether the user will have access to exporting OLE objects from the export dialog. Setting | Descrip... | |
| AllowPage1 | PeUserInterface.Dialog.Page1 | Boolean/Int32 | This property controls whether the first general property page is visible. Property pages are shown in the customization dia... | |
| AllowPage23ex | PeUserInterface.Dialog.Page2 | Boolean/Int32 | This property controls whether the second general property page is visible. Property pages are shown in the customization di... | |
| AllowPlotCustomization3ex | PeUserInterface.Dialog.PlotCustomization | Boolean/Int32 | This property controls whether the user will have access to changing the objects plotting method. Setting | Description TRU... | |
| AllowPoint3ex | PePlot.Allow.Point | Boolean/Int32 | This property controls whether the Point plotting method is accessible to the user. Setting | Description TRUE | Point Grap... | |
| AllowPointHotSpots2ex | PeUserInterface.HotSpot.Point | Boolean/Int32 | This property controls whether point labels will be Hot-Spots. The developer can then respond when the user clicks or double... | |
| AllowPointsPage | PeUserInterface.Dialog.Points | Boolean/Int32 | This property controls whether the Points property page is visible. Property pages are shown in the customization dialog. Th... | |
| AllowPointsPlusLine3ex | PePlot.Allow.PointsPlusLine | Boolean/Int32 | This property controls whether the Points Plus Line plotting method is accessible to the user. Setting | Description TRUE |... | |
| AllowPointsPlusSpline3ex | PePlot.Allow.PointsPlusSpline | Boolean/Int32 | This property controls whether the Points Plus Spline plotting method is accessible to the user. Setting | Description TRUE... |
Your success is our #1 goal by providing the easiest and most professional benefit to your organization and end-users.
ProEssentials was born from professional Electrical Engineers needing their own charting components. Join our large list of top engineering companies using ProEssentials.
Thank you for being a ProEssentials customer, and thank you for researching the ProEssentials charting engine.